Ram Nath Kovind to visit Tajikistan tomorrow

| @indiablooms | Oct 06, 2018, at 05:44 pm

New Delhi, Oct 6 (IBNS): President of India Ram Nath Kovind will pay a State Visit to Tajikistan from Oct 7 to 9.

During his visit, he will meet President of Tajikistan Emamoli Rahmon. The Speaker of the Parliament  Shukurjon Zuhurov, Speaker (Chairman) of the Lower House (Majlisi Namoyandagon) of Parliament and the Prime Minister of Tajikistan Qohir Rasulzoda will call on the President.

Dr. Shubhash R. Bhamre, Raksha Rajya Mantri and Shamsher Singh Manhas, Hon’ble Member of Parliament (Rajya Sabha) will also be part of Rashtrapatiji’s official delegation. The current visit is a standalone visit to Tajikistan.

The President will visit the Tajik National University where he will deliver an address on ‘Countering Radicalization: Challenges in Modern Societies’. He will address the members of the Indian Diaspora in Tajikistan.

The President will pay his respects to Mahatma Gandhi and Rabindranath Tagore by visiting their memorials in Dushanbe and will offer floral tributes.
During the visit of the President, all areas of bilateral, regional and multilateral cooperation are expected to be discussed.

Given the close relationship between the two countries, the visit is expected to lead to further strengthening of Indo-Tajik bilateral relations.

This will be the very first visit of Ram Nath Kovind to Central Asia.
